Deutsche Bank initiated coverage of Bowhead Specialty (BOW) with a Buy rating and $39 price target The company’s focus on the casualty excess and surplus market makes it one of the few public insurers still benefitting from meaningful cyclical tailwinds, the analyst tells investors in a research note. The firm sees this continuing given concerns around social inflation. With no liabilities from accident years prior to 2020, Bowhead is free from the reserve distractions, the analyst tells investors in a research note.
